Target Background

Function
Major helicase player in mitochondrial RNA metabolism. Component of the mitochondrial degradosome (mtEXO) complex, that degrades 3' overhang double-stranded RNA with a 3'-to-5' directionality in an ATP-dependent manner. Involved in the degradation of non-coding mitochondrial transcripts (MT-ncRNA) and tRNA-like molecules. ATPase and ATP-dependent multisubstrate helicase, able to unwind double-stranded (ds) DNA and RNA, and RNA/DNA heteroduplexes in the 5'-to-3' direction. Plays a role in the RNA surveillance system in mitochondria; regulates the stability of mature mRNAs, the removal of aberrantly formed mRNAs and the rapid degradation of non coding processing intermediates. Also implicated in recombination and chromatin maintenance pathways. May protect cells from apoptosis. Associates with mitochondrial DNA.
Gene References into Functions
  1. the nucleolar- associated human SUV3 protein is an important factor in regulation of the cell cycle. PMID: 28291845
  2. the capacity of hSuv3 DNA unwinding activity might be sensitive to the local availability of specific inorganic cofactors PMID: 25446650
  3. SUV3 bridges PNPase and mtPAP to form a transient complex in modulating mt-mRNA poly(A) tail length depending on the mitochondrial matrix Pi level. PMID: 24770417
  4. Interaction between PNPase and hSuv3 is essential for efficient mitochondrial RNA degradation. PMID: 23221631
  5. The hSuv3p activity was found to be necessary in the regulation of stability of mature, properly formed mRNAs and for removal of the noncoding processing intermediates transcribed from both H and L-strands. PMID: 19864255
  6. Localisation of hSuv3p helicase in the mitochondrial matrix and its preferential unwinding of dsDNA. PMID: 12466530
  7. Human SUV3 is an ATP-dependent multiple-substrate helicase; in addition to dsRNA and dsDNA unwinding activity, SUV3-70 and SUV3-83 can unwind heteroduplexes of RNA and DNA. PMID: 15096047
  8. data suggest that hSUV3 is a housekeeping gene with an enhancer region & regulatory elements in basal promoter PMID: 15919122
  9. Suv3 protein interacts with HBXIP, previously identified as a cofactor of survivin in suppression of apoptosis PMID: 16176273
  10. Down-regulation of hSUV3 results in cell cycle perturbations and in apoptosis, which is both AIF- and caspase-dependent, and proceeds with the induction of p53. PMID: 17352692
  11. Human SUV3 protein interacts with human WRN and BLM helicases. Silencing of the SUV3 gene in the human cell line HeLa resulted in elevation of homologous recombination as measured by the frequency of sister chromatid exchange during mitotic cell division. PMID: 17961633
  12. SUV3 is essential for maintaining proper mitochondrial function, likely through a conserved role in mitochondrial RNA regulation. PMID: 18678873
  13. The complex of hSUV3-hPNPase is an integral entity for efficient degradation of structured RNA and may be the long sought RNA-degrading complex in the mammalian mitochondria. PMID: 19509288

Subcellular Location
Nucleus. Mitochondrion matrix. Mitochondrion matrix, mitochondrion nucleoid.
Protein Families
Helicase family
Tissue Specificity
Broadly expressed.
